NFRC rating system and labeling system for energy performance windows doors, skylights, and attachment products

The National Fenestration Rating Council is an independent non-profit corporation that provides an uniform and independent labeling system that evaluates the energy efficiency of windows and doors skylights, windows, and other products for attachment. This label allows consumers to make informed choices regarding energy-efficient products.

Energy ratings complement other NFRC labels, which include structural performance and air quality ratings. These ratings can be used to determine the energy efficiency of buildings.

A window is rated according the U-factor and R value. The U-factor determines the product's insulation value. The R-value is the insulation value of other components within the building envelope.

Certain energy ratings are built on computer simulations, while others are determined by actual measurements of solar heat gain. Any method can help you determine if a particular product is appropriate for your home.

While most window ratings have the identical parameters, they might differ from one area to another. This is due to the necessity of adapting to the latest technologies.

Ratings are used to determine the insulative value of a window. They also quantify the performance and durability of sealants, weatherstripping or insulating glass units. They also assess the light transmission of the visible light.

NFRC labels are available for various regions and can provide more information about a product other than the U-factor or R-value. They offer ratings for Solar Heat Gain Coefficient, Visible Light Transmittance Air Leakage, Condensation Resistance, and many more.

The NFRC-certified products have been independently examined and certified by a third-party. The certification process involves an independent examination of the product's manufacturing and design, as well as participation in the NFRC rating and labeling system.

The NFRC is a member of several companies involved in the fenestration sector. The organization was founded in response to the energy crisis in the 1970s. Today, NFRC is composed of manufacturers, government agencies, researchers, and suppliers. The NFRC's ratings are used in all major energy efficiency programs.
